The response time and refresh rate on the Plasma is still 4-5x better than the LCD's. SO my gaming and sports/movie TV in the media room is Plasma. Everything else is LED LCD because it's "good enough".

In a recent review, Consumer Reports talked up plasmas saying that over time, manufacturers have dealt with the old burn-in, high power consumption, etc., issues. They said to mainly make choices on features and how it looks to you -- but that technically, plasmas still had slightly better picture (esp. contrast ratio) than LCD's.
